    ggplot2

    ggplot2

    An implementation of the Grammar of Graphics in R

    ggplot2 is a system written in R for declaratively creating graphics. It is based on The Grammar of Graphics, which focuses on following a layered approach to describe and construct visualizations or graphics in a structured manner.     sf (Simple Features)

    sf (Simple Features)

    Simple Features for R

    sf is an R package that implements “simple features” (standardized vector spatial data) for R. It allows spatial vector data (points, lines, polygons etc.) to be represented as records in data frames (or tibbles) with geometry list columns, and performs spatial operations (geometry operations, coordinate reference system transformations, reading/writing spatial data, integration with spatial databases etc.).     circlize

    circlize

    Circular visualization in R

    circlize is an R package for creating circular visualizations (plots laid out in circular coordinate systems) in a very flexible way. It implements many types of plots using circular layouts: chord diagrams, circular heatmaps, arcs/links between sectors, genomic data visualization, etc. It provides low-level drawing functions as well as high-level functions to build complex visualizations.
